数据库访问小工具VB6是一款基于Visual Basic 6(VB6)开发的应用程序,它提供了对数据库的便捷操作功能。VB6是微软推出的一种可视化编程工具,主要用于开发Windows平台上的应用程序。这款工具允许用户通过直观的界面与各种类型的数据库进行交互,如Microsoft Access、SQL Server、Oracle等。 在VB6中,数据库访问主要依赖于ADO(ActiveX Data Objects),这是一个微软的数据库访问组件,它提供了一组统一的接口来连接和操作不同的数据库系统。ADO包括Recordset、Connection、Command等核心对象,用于执行SQL查询、检索和更新数据。 这款数据库访问小工具可能包含以下功能: 1. **连接管理**:用户可以输入数据库连接信息,如服务器地址、数据库名称、用户名和密码,创建一个Connection对象以建立与数据库的连接。 2. **数据浏览**:通过Recordset对象,用户可以查看数据库中的表数据,并以表格形式显示出来,支持滚动、排序和筛选操作。 3. **SQL查询**:工具可能允许用户编写自定义SQL语句执行查询,或者提供预设的查询模板,如选择、插入、更新和删除操作。 4. **数据编辑**:用户可以直接在界面上修改Recordset中的数据,包括添加新记录、修改现有记录和删除记录,这些更改通常会通过Command对象的Execute方法提交到数据库。 5. **事务处理**:对于需要确保数据完整性的操作,工具可能支持事务处理,确保一组数据库操作要么全部成功,要么全部回滚。 6. **数据导出导入**:工具可能提供将数据库数据导出为CSV或Excel格式的功能,反之亦可将外部数据导入数据库。 7. **错误处理**:VB6的On Error语句可用于设置错误处理程序,当发生错误时,程序可以捕获并处理异常,提供友好的错误信息给用户。 8. **用户界面设计**:VB6的拖放式界面设计使得创建用户友好的图形界面变得简单,按钮、文本框、列表框等控件的使用让数据库操作直观易用。 9. **代码重用**:VB6支持模块和类的创建,可以将常用的数据库操作封装成函数或子过程,提高代码的可读性和可维护性。 在实际应用中,开发者可能会根据需求扩展这个工具,添加更多定制化的功能,如报表生成、数据验证规则、数据库备份恢复等。对于初学者,通过学习和使用这样的工具,可以深入理解VB6与数据库的交互原理,进一步提升数据库管理和应用程序开发的能力。
2024-07-13 18:19:35 37KB
1
介绍了漏钢预报监测系统总体结构及监测变量选取;分析了LabVIEW访问数据库的几种方式,并选用LabSQL工具包访问数据库;给出了在LabVIEW中通过LabSQL访问Access数据库的实现方法,并将其应用到漏钢预报监测系统中。通过LabSQL访问数据库的方法简单易行,降低了设计成本,经实践证明是切实可行的。
2023-12-14 20:30:13 507KB 漏钢预报 LabVIEW 数据库访问 LabSQL
1
通用数据库访问类 通过配置 可实现不同数据库的的访问&def目前实现了SQLserver&def Oracle&def DataAccess 调用: IDBOperator idb = DBOperator.GetInstance(); string sqlAccess = @"SELECT * FROM Orders"; DataTable dt = idb.ReturnDataTable(sqlAccess);
2023-11-27 05:03:44 174KB 数据库访问类
1
轻量级数据访问类,采用反射工厂模式支持多种数据库的访问,实现了数据库的常规访问、存储过程调用、事务处理等功能。可用于不同用途的数据库系统开发。 代码和使用文档均为本人自己编写,仅用于交流研究,若有错误和不足希望大家指正或提出更佳方案。
2023-10-28 05:02:11 1.32MB C# 反射工厂 数据库访问类 源码
1
介绍了中间件技术在B/S多层体系结构中的作用,分析了CGI,ASP,JDBC等中间件技术各自的特点和它们在Web数据库访问中的应用,最后给出了基于Servlet/JSP技术的Web数据库访问技术的实现模型。
2023-07-03 16:18:32 22KB 中间件 Web数据库 CGI ASP ADO JDBC Servlet JSP
1
c# Winform通过T4模板生成model、数据库访问层、业务层,为你节约大量的开发时间
2023-05-30 20:50:57 79.9MB c# Winform T4 代码生成器
1
实验8-jdbc数据库访问.doc
2023-02-28 17:12:40 140KB 实验8-jdbc数据库访问
1
自己编写的一个c++ 版sqlite数据库访问帮助类,主要对sqlite的常用的几个接口函数进行封装成一个类,实现查询、事务处理等基本数据库访问应用,简单,好用,希望对大家有用,注意传人的参数是stl 的string 类型,CString类型传入要进行简单的转换,以后会完善这点的。
2023-01-19 15:58:14 317KB c++ sqlite数据库访问类 sqlite帮助类
1
matlab开发-质量弹簧振子微分方程的应用。求解含弹簧微分方程的程序
2023-01-13 20:44:13 95KB 数据库访问和报告
1
针对数据库访问控制中存在的问题,提出将区块链技术应用于数据库访问控制的思想。从区块链层次结构、访问控制过程的逻辑层次结构、访问控制的实现原理、访问控制的共识认证原理以及访问控制区块链体系的构建机制几个方面设计了基于区块链的数据库访问控制实现机制,对基于区块链的数据库访问控制体系的性能进行评价。为区块链应用于数据库访问控制提供了完整的架构,通过对访问者身份、访问权限及访问行为强化认证与监管,有效地提高了数据库访问控制的能力。
2022-12-07 08:26:20 878KB 数据库 访问控制 区块链 实现机制
1